Form 10-K For the Fiscal Year Ended December 31, 2005

Item 9a. Controls and Procedures, page 45
1. Your conclusion that your disclosure controls and procedures
are
effective "...in timely alerting them to material information
relating to RightNow (or its consolidated subsidiaries) required
to
be included in the reports we file or submit under the Securities
and
Exchange Act of 1934" is significantly more limited than what is
called for under Rule13a-15(e) of the Exchange Act.  The rule
requires, among other matters, that the disclosure controls and
procedures be designed "to ensure that information required to be
disclosed by the issuer in the reports that it files or submits
under
the Act . . . is recorded, processed, summarized and reported,
within
the time periods specified in the Commission`s rules and forms"
and
to ensure that "information required to be disclosed by an issuer
.. .
.. is accumulated and communicated to the issuer`s management . . .
as
appropriate to allow timely decisions regarding required
disclosure."
Please confirm, if true, that your disclosure controls and
procedures
for the relevant periods met all of the requirements of this
section.
Additionally, tell us how you intend to comply with this
requirement
by including this statement in your controls and procedures
section
of your periodic reports.
Financial Statements
Consolidated Statements of Operations, page F-3

2. We note your presentation of software, hosting and support
revenues as a single line item with in the Company`s Consolidated
Statements of Operations.  Tell us how you considered presenting
software, hosting and support revenues  and related cost of
revenues
as separate line items on the face of your Consolidated Statement
of
Operations pursuant to Rule 5-03 (b) 1 and 2 of Regulation S-X.
We
remind you that the aforementioned Rule does not prohibit
allocating
revenues between product and service revenues and cost of revenues
based on reasonable estimates.
